Screwworm

What to know: The Texas Department of Agriculture warns that New World screwworms, a bot fly that preys on cattle, have been detected just 119 miles south of the U.S. border with Mexico.

https://www.beefmagazine.com/livestock-management/commissioner-miller-alerts-texans-as-new-world-screwworm-detected-in-coahuila

The TPPF take: If left unchecked, the screwworm could decimate American cattle, horses, and wildlife.

“Once it’s here, eradicating it could take decades and cost billions,” says TPPF’s Selene Rodriguez. “The last time it happened, our livestock industry took 30 years to bounce back. While Mexico cries foul, it’s time we stop pretending we’re dealing with a friendly, cooperative neighbor. We’re not.”
